King Street Station, Seattle
King Street Station in Seattle stands as a testament to early 20th-century architecture and the city's rich railway history. Travelers are drawn to its grand waiting room, adorned with ornate ceilings and marble finishes. Vloggers often focus on the station's clock tower, a recognizable feature of Seattle's skyline. As a hub for Amtrak and regional trains, it connects visitors to various destinations across the Pacific Northwest.
